Mutations in CIC and FUBP1 Contribute to Human Oligodendroglioma
Mutations in CIC and FUBP1 Contribute to Human Oligodendroglioma
A gene originally studied for its role in fruit fly embryogenesis is implicated in the growth of a common human brain tumor.
